A car is moving in a circular path of radius 500m with a speed of 30m/s. If the speed is increasing, at the rate of 2m/s2 the resultant acceleration will be
A body moving in circular motion, has radial (aR) and tangential acceleration (aT). Hence, resultant acceleration is given by a=aT2+aR2
Given, aT=2m/s2, aR=rv2=50030×30=1.8m/s2 ∴a=(1.8)2+(2)2=7.24 ⇒a=2.69≈2.7m/s2
